The Institute also conducts and supports research and research training related to disease prevention and health promotion; addresses special biomedical and behavioral problems associated with people who have communication impairments or disorders; and supports efforts to create devices which substitute for lost and impaired sensory and communication function. NIDCD public education activities include: providing reports of breaking science and health information, developing science education materials to improve health and science education opportunities for children and teachers from K-12, and building and supporting coalitions and public education campaigns around disease prevention and health promotion.
